Transaction 69e807318221fc549c28e4e12d9bbd985f61d2fd6cb41c6aabf51a78f9c7da74

15 Input
1 Outputs
  • 69e807318221fc549c28e4e12d9bbd985f61d2fd6cb41c6aabf51a78f9c7da74:0
  • value  65448203
    address  1LeT8op12etQouJskCjP82E5FJkFFNPzxk